What if authenticity isn't about becoming one true version of yourself, but learning to recognize all the parts that make you who you are? After two years of solo travel across 50 countries, I discovered that authenticity, self-discovery, and personal growth aren't nearly as simple as I once believed. Some parts of us remain constant no matter where we are. Others naturally evolve through new experiences, different cultures, and the unexpected moments that shape our lives. And then there are the versions of ourselves that emerge from fear, stress, or the need to survive. In this episode, I share what years of travel taught me about authenticity, identity, and self-awareness. We explore how stepping outside familiar routines can reveal your authentic self, why different environments bring out different parts of who we are, and why giving yourself permission to evolve may be one of the most authentic things you can do. Whether you've traveled the world or are simply navigating a season of personal growth, this conversation is an invitation to embrace change, deepen your self-awareness, and discover that authenticity isn't about staying the same. It's about becoming more fully yourself. In this episode, you'll explore: How solo travel can accelerate self-discovery and personal growth What years of travel taught me about authenticity and identity The difference between your core self, your adaptive self, and your survival self Why new environments reveal parts of yourself you didn't know existed How embracing change leads to greater authenticity and self-awareness
